UserSettingsDatabaseEditRow implements FormDataProviderInterface
Read onlyYes
FormDataProvider for backend user settings.
Loads user data from BE_USER->user and BE_USER->uc into databaseRow for the user settings form.
Table of Contents
Interfaces
- FormDataProviderInterface
- Interface must be implemented by form data provider classes.
Methods
- addData() : array<string|int, mixed>
- Add form data to result array
- getAvatarFileUid() : int
- getBackendUser() : BackendUserAuthentication
Methods
addData()
Add form data to result array
public
addData(array<string|int, mixed> $result) : array<string|int, mixed>
Parameters
- $result : array<string|int, mixed>
-
Initialized result array
Return values
array<string|int, mixed> —Result filled with more data
getAvatarFileUid()
protected
getAvatarFileUid(int $beUserId) : int
Parameters
- $beUserId : int
Return values
intgetBackendUser()
protected
getBackendUser() : BackendUserAuthentication